Hi, Python 3.7 reached end of life[1] in June 2023 (7 months ago).
Currently there is no OpenIndiana package that depends on Python 3.7, except some Python modules that are otherwise unused. They are still sitting in the IPS package repository waiting for their obsoletion. We are slowly obsoleting them but since there are hundreds of such packages the process is slow. The slowness of the process does have some negative side effects for end users so here is the heads up and a suggestion how to solve such issues. The issue you could encounter is a failure when you try to install or upgrade some packages, for example: # pkg install library/python/rbtools Creating Plan (Running solver): - pkg install: No matching version of library/python/rbtools can be installed: Reject: pkg://openindiana.org/library/python/rbtools@4.1-2023.0.0.0:20230525T122724Z Reason: No version matching 'conditional' dependency library/python/rbtools-37@4.1-2023.0.0.0 can be installed ---------------------------------------- Reject: pkg://openindiana.org/library/python/rbtools-37@4.1-2023.0.0.0:20230525T122701Z Reason: All acceptable versions of 'require' dependency on library/python/certifi-37 are obsolete ---------------------------------------- # Please note that not only library/python/* packages are affected. Basically any package that depends on any Python-related package could be affected similarly. When you see similar failure stating that some package ending with '-37' cannot be installed, then you are affected by this. How to solve the issue? The solution is easy: Uninstall all Python 3.7 related packages from your system using command like: # pkg uninstall -v runtime/python-37 \ 'library/python/*-37' \ web/server/apache-24/module/apache-wsgi-37 The removal of Python 3.7 packages is recommended even if you currently do not see any issue related to Python 3.7.
